z/OS
z/OS («zero downtime Operating System») er et proprietært 64-biter operativsystem som blir utviklet av IBM. z/OS er ikke portabelt, men er spesialsydd og optimalisert for datamaskinarkitekturen IBM z/Architecture. Dette er en 64-biter CISC-arkitektur som brukes i IBM stormaskiner. Arkitekturen kjennetegnes ved høy tilgjengelighet – av IBM betegnet som «zero downtime» (null tid nede), noe som vitner om stabilitet og pålitelighet. z/OS har en monolittisk operativsystemkjerne liksom i de fleste tradisjonelle operativsystemer.
Z/OS | |||
---|---|---|---|
Utvikler(e) | IBM | ||
Nyeste versjon | 3.1 (29. september 2023)[1] | ||
Plattform | z/Architecture | ||
Skrevet i | PL/X | ||
Nettsted | http://www-03.ibm.com/systems/z/os/zos/index.html | ||
Forgjenger | OS/390 |
z/OS ble kunngjort av IBM den 3. oktober 2000, og ble formelt lansert den 30. mars 2001. Siste versjon er 3.1 (V3R1), og ble lansert den 29. september 2023.
OS/360-familien
redigerOperativsystemer for IBM stormaskiner ble innledet med OS/360 (1965), og ble etterfulgt av MVS (1974) og OS/390 (1995). Disse ble brukt på 32-biter stormaskinene IBM System/360, IBM System/370 og IBM ESA/390. z/OS er laget for en 64-biter arkitektur, men er kompatibel med programvare for OS/360, MVS og OS/390. Liksom OS/390, kombinerer z/OS en rekke tidligere separate programvareprodukter, og noen av dem er fortsatt valgfrie. z/OS har bevart mye av funksjonaliteten fra 1965 og fremover, og tilbyr i dag attributtene til et moderne operativsystem.
Tidsdeling
redigerz/OS er et tidsdelt operativsystem, men er ikke en avart av UNIX og er heller ikke et Unix-lignende operativsystem liksom Linux, FreeBSD og flere. I UNIX har tidsdeling vært innbakt fra starten, mens z/OS tilhører en familie operativsystemer hvor dette opprinnelig ble tilbudt som en valgmulighet (Time Sharing Option). Siden 1986 har IBM også brukt UNIX-avarten AIX på sine stormaskiner; men dette er et annet operativsystem enn z/OS og dets forgjengere.[a]
POSIX-kompatibelt
redigerEt kompatibiltetslag for UNIX (UNIX System Services),[2] gjør det likevel mulig for z/OS å kjøre UNIX-applikasjoner som følger Single UNIX Specification. Dette kompatibilitetslaget tilbyr også et programmeringsgrensesnitt (API) for samme spesifikasjon. Open Group har sertifisert z/OS som et UNIX-kompatibelt operativsystem som følger standarden XPG4 UNIX 95 (men ikke forgjengeren UNIX 93, og heller ikke etterfølgerne UNIX 98, UNIX 03 og UNIX V7). UNIX-kompatibiliteten gjør at z/OS kan kjøre en lang rekke programvare, både kommersiell og med fri og åpen kildekode. Filsystemene til z/OS – Hierarchical File System (HFS) som ble innført for MVS i 1993, såvel som zFS som ble introdusert for OS/390 i 1995, har en hierarkisk UNIX/Linux-lignende stil. Begge filsystemene er POSIX-kompatible.
Versjonshistorikk
redigerIBM oppgir følgende versjonshistorikk til z/OS:[3]
Versjon | Kunngjort | Lansert | Støttet inntil | Ordrenr. |
---|---|---|---|---|
z/OS V1R1 (Version 1, Release 1) |
3. oktober 2000 200-352 |
30. mars 2001 | 31. mars 2004 | 5694-A01 |
z/OS V1R2 (Version 1, Release 2) |
11. september 2001 201-248 |
26. oktober 2001 | 31. oktober 2004 | |
z/OS V1R3 (Version 1, Release 3) |
19. februar 2002 202-031 |
29. mars 2002 | 31. mars 2005 | |
z/OS V1R4 (Version 1, Release 4) |
13. august 2002 202-190 |
27. september 2002 | 31. mars 2007 | |
z/OS V1R5 (Version 1, Release 5) |
10. februar 2004 204-017 |
26. mars 2004 | 31. mars 2007 | |
z/OS V1R6 (Version 1, Release 6) |
10. august 2004 204-180 |
24. september 2004 | 30. september 2007 | |
z/OS V1R7 (Version 1, Release 7) |
27. juli 2005 205-167 |
30. september 2005 | 20. september 2008 | |
z/OS V1R8 (Version 1, Release 8) |
8. august 2006 206-190 |
29. september 2006 | 30. september 2009 | |
z/OS V1R9 (Version 1, Release 9) |
8. august 2007 207-175 |
28. september 2007 | 30. september 2010 | |
z/OS V1R10 (Version 1, Release 10) |
5. august 2008 208-186 |
26. september 2008 | 30. september 2011 | |
z/OS V1R11 (Version 1, Release 11) |
18. august 2009 209-242 |
25. september 2009 | 30. september 2012 | |
z/OS V1R12 (Version 1, Release 12) |
22. juli 2010 210-235 |
24. september 2010 | 30. september 2014 | |
z/OS V1R13 (Version 1, Release 13) |
12. juli 2011 211-252 |
30. september 2011 | 30. september 2016 | |
z/OS V2R1 (Version 2, Release 1) |
23. juli 2013 213-292 |
20. september 2013 | 30. september 2019 | 5650-ZOS |
z/OS V2R2 (Version 2, Release 2) |
28. juli 2015 215-267 |
30. september 2015 | 30. september 2021 | |
z/OS V2R3 (Version 2, Release 3) |
21. februar 2017[4] 217-085 |
29. september 2017 | 30. september 2022 | |
z/OS V2R4 (Version 2, Release 4) |
26. februar 2019[5] LP19-0013 |
30. september 2019 | 30. september 2024 | |
z/OS V2R5 (Version 2, Release 5) |
27. juni 2021 221-260 |
30. september 2021 | ||
z/OS V3R1 (Version 3, Release 1) |
28. september 2023 223-012 |
29. september 2023 | 5655-ZOS | |
z/OS V3R2 (Version 3, Release 2) |
Noter
rediger- ^ I årene 2008–2010 fantes OpenSolaris for System z; dette var en avart av operativsystemet Solaris for z/Architecture. Linux on System z er en fellesbetegnelse på Linuxdistribusjoner som er uten historisk tilknytning til z/OS. De omfatter primært Red Hat Enterprise Linux, SUSE Linux Enterprise Server og Ubuntu, men også Debian, Fedora, CentOS, Slackware og Gentoo. Siden 9. juli 2019 blir Red Hat Enterprise Linux og Fedora utviklet av IBM.
Referanser
rediger- ^ https://www.ibm.com/support/pages/zos310; besøksdato: 25. august 2024.
- ^ OMVS, billlalonde.tripod.com, besøkt 28. mai 2017
- ^ IBM: z/OS, z/OS.e, and OS/390 marketing and service announce, availability, and withdrawal dates, ibm.com, besøkt 30. mai 2017
- ^ Preview: IBM z/OS Version 2 Release 3 - Engine for digital transformation, IBM United States Software Announcement 217-085, 21. februar 2017
- ^ Preview: IBM z/OS Version 2 Release 4, IBM Latin America Software Announcement LP19-0013, 26. februar 2019
Eksterne lenker
rediger- (en) Offisielt nettsted
- IBM: Shop zSeries (ShopZ)
- IBM: z/OS Internet Library
- IBM Systems Mainframe Magazine Arkivert 6. februar 2015 hos Wayback Machine.